Math Day Celebration: Balvatika III to Grade II

DPS Surajkund commemorated National Mathematics Day with great enthusiasm to mark the birth anniversary of the legendary mathematician Mr. Srinivasa Ramanujan. The celebration for students from Balvatika III to Grade II was thoughtfully designed to align with NEP 2020’s foundational learning principles, emphasizing experiential, play-based, and hands-on activities.

The day focused on fostering mathematical thinking, problem-solving skills, and spatial awareness rather than mere calculation. Classrooms were abuzz with excitement as students engaged in number games, shape recognition, counting exercises, puzzles, and sorting activities. Specially designed learning corners and movement-based challenges allowed children to explore numbers, patterns, and shapes in an enjoyable and meaningful way, catering to visual, auditory, and kinesthetic learners.

Through hands-on games and tasks, students discovered that mathematics is an integral part of everyday life. The activities encouraged curiosity, confidence, and a positive attitude towards learning, helping young learners build a strong foundation in numeracy while nurturing a love for mathematics.

The celebration was not only educational but also joyful, providing a refreshing break from routine lessons and reinforcing the idea that math can be fun, creative, and engaging. It was a delightful experience for our little Dipsites, inspiring them to think logically and explore the magical world of numbers

The adage "All work and no play make Jack a dull boy" reflects our belief in the essential balance between academics and sports to unlock a child's full potential. This equilibrium not only fosters gross motor skills but also cultivates valuable personal attributes like teamwork, leadership, dedication, discipline, self-confidence, and self-esteem.

Sports, we believe, imparts crucial life lessons that academics alone cannot provide. Our Physical Education program is meticulously designed to support a child's physical, social, emotional, and intellectual growth. It encourages an appreciation for movement and the body's creative expression, fostering a positive attitude towards an active and healthy lifestyle. In the Foundation years, students engage in the Fundamental Skills Program, which teaches balancing, running, jumping, catching, and throwing while promoting hand-eye coordination through enjoyable team-building games.
